How they compare

Iceland currently reports 312,177 current US$ per square kilometre against 305,729 current US$ per square kilometre in Gambia, a difference of 6,448 current US$ per square kilometre.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 54 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Iceland ahead.

Gambia ranks 113th and Iceland ranks 111th of 183 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Gambia averaged higher in 1 and Iceland in 5.
